Damaged tile replacement services involve removing broken, cracked, or otherwise compromised tiles and installing new ones in their place. This process helps restore the appearance and functionality of tiled surfaces, ensuring they remain safe and durable. Whether tiles are chipped, shattered, or have become loose over time, professional contractors can carefully remove the damaged sections without harming surrounding tiles, then replace them seamlessly to match the existing design.
This service addresses a variety of common problems homeowners face with tiled areas. Cracked or broken tiles can pose safety hazards, especially in high-traffic zones like kitchens and bathrooms. Water damage, mold, or deterioration due to age can also compromise tile integrity, leading to further issues if not addressed promptly. Damaged tiles can also detract from the overall aesthetic of a space, making it look worn or neglected. Repairing or replacing individual tiles is a practical way to improve both safety and appearance without the need for a full surface overhaul.

The overview below groups typical Damaged Tile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or tile repairs usually range from $100 to $300, covering simple fixes like replacing a few damaged tiles.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of damage and tile type.
Moderate Replacement - replacing several damaged tiles or a small section generally costs between $250 and $600. Local contractors often handle projects in this range, which can vary based on tile material and accessibility.
Full Room Replacement - replacing all damaged tiles in a room can cost from $1,000 to $3,000, especially for larger areas or complex patterns. Larger, more involved projects tend to push into higher price brackets.
Complete Floor Overhaul - extensive damage requiring a full floor replacement may range from $4,000 to $8,000 or more, depending on the size and tile quality. Such projects are less common but can reach higher costs for premium materials and intricate installations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
